Output 35683d593c77a9a1c3a43362a18c4c0ae8d73fb535b83af777dfd3cfedd0c8a3:3

value
3109900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c824ae9fa2f3f3e72bad5588229f1d32290f6d56 OP_EQUAL
address
3KwH1dQMxYV5iw3taF9f4E5i21GpkbNNZ5
transaction
35683d593c77a9a1c3a43362a18c4c0ae8d73fb535b83af777dfd3cfedd0c8a3
spent
true